For sale is a 2004 Subaru Impreza WRX. This car is in great condition and has been maintained by the book. The car just passed
PA State Inspection in June and needed nothing. The car will have its oil changed in the next 200 miles, and has no problems.
It has been changed with synthetic oil since 30k miles.
The car has been in the family since new. I have all paperwork and records, including original window sticker.
The brakes and tires have about 50% life meaning the car will need nothing for a year or 7500 miles.
The body work has very mild dings and chips but otherwise has great bodywork. The interior is very clean and has mild wear given its age.
There are dents and mild scratches on the rear door jambs, due to people closing the door with the seat belt buckle still in the door.
There are no rips or tears in the seats. The trunk carpeting is discolored due to a spill years ago, but otherwise this car is in impressive condition.
The car is daily driven, so mileage will be going up slowly. The car is located in Hatboro, PA.
The few but tasteful modifications include:
ENGINE/DRIVETRAIN
STi Short Throw Shifter (Factory installed option)
BRAKES
Hawk HPS Pads Front & Rear (Excellent all around pads, no noise, low dust, great performance)
H6 Rear Rotor Upgrade (Balances brake bias closer to neutral, larger rear rotors also look better)
Goodridge SS Lines (Great improvement in pedal feel and the SS lines will never degrade)
ATE Super Blue Fluid
SUSPENSION/WHEELS
Kartboy Front Endlinks (Stock front endlinks wore out, this is a stronger replacement)
STi Fender Braces (Helps steering feel and turn in with no increase in NVH)

Bentley Continental GT V8 and Toyota 4Runner | Autoblog Podcast #604
Fri, Nov 15 2019In this week's Autoblog Podcast, Editor-in-Chief Greg Migliore is joined by Consumer Editor Jeremy Korzeniewski and Senior Editor, Green, John Beltz Snyder. First, they talk about driving the 2020 Bentley Continental GT V8 First Edition, followed by the 2020 Toyota 4Runner TRD Off-Road. Then they revive a format called "This or That," discussing the Jeep Wrangler vs. Gladiator, Subaru Forester vs. Outback, Mustang vs. Camaro vs. Challenger, and whether they'd rather spend $25,000 on a new or vintage car. They've got an update on a previous Spend My Money segment, and, finally, they help another listener pick a daily driver.
